    Single-photon transport in a one dimentional waveguide coupling to a hybrid atom-optomechanical system

    We explore theoretically the single-photon transport in a single-mode waveguide that is coupled to a hybrid atom-optomechanical system in a strong optomechanical coupling regime. Using a full quantum real-space approach, transmission and reflection coefficients of the propagating single-photon in the waveguide are ob- tained. The influences of atom-cavity detuning and the dissipation of atom on the transport are also studied.     Feasibility of remote evaporation and precipitation estimates

    Remote sensing by means of stereo images obtained from flown cameras and scanners provides the potential to monitor the dynamics of pollutant mixing over large areas. Moreover, stereo technology may permit monitoring of pollutant concentration and mixing with sufficient detail to ascertain the structure of a polluted air mass. Consequently, stereo remote systems can be employed to supply data to set forth adequate regional standards on air quality. A method of remote sensing using stereo images is described. Preliminary results concerning the planar extent of a plume based on comparison with ground measurements by an alternate method, e.g., remote hot-wire anemometer technique, are supporting the feasibility of using stereo remote sensing systems

    Earthquake source parameters of the 2009 Mw 7.8 Fiordland (New Zealand) earthquake from L-band InSAR observations

    The 2009 MW7.8 Fiordland (New Zealand) earthquake is the largest to have occurred in New Zealand since the 1931 Mw 7.8 Hawke’s Bay earthquake, 1 000 km to the northwest. In this paper two tracks of ALOS PALSAR interferograms (one ascending and one descending) are used to determine fault geometry and slip distribution of this large earthquake. Modeling the event as dislocation in an elastic half-space suggests that the earthquake resulted from slip on a SSW-NNE orientated thrust fault that is associated with the subduction between the Pacific and Australian Plates, with oblique displacement of up to 6.3 m. This finding is consistent with the preliminary studies undertaken by the USGS using seismic data

    Analysing B2B electronic procurement benefits – Information systems perspective

    This paper presents electronic procurement benefits identified in four case companies. The benefits achieved in the case companies were classified according to taxonomies from the Information Systems discipline. Existing taxonomies were combined into a new taxonomy which allows evaluation of the complex e-procurement impact. Traditional financial-based methods failed to capture the nature of e-procurement benefits. In the new taxonomy, eprocurement benefits are classified using scorecard dimensions (strategic, tactical and operational), which allows the identification of areas of e-procurement impact, in addition the benefits characteristic is captured (tangible, intangible, financial and non-financial)

    Information systems evaluation in context–impact of the corporate level

    The paper presents the results of a doctoral research related to Information Systems evaluation in context. The authors propose changes in the context, the new level of contextual analysis was added: the system context located between the internal and external context. The system context reflects the fact that the case companies are business units and parts of the corporations and IS evaluation is influenced by the corporation, Three levels of context analysis can be used in case of IS evaluation in complex structures, such as corporations or supply chain
